The Opportunity

We are seeking a Paralegal to join our Disputes practice in Bangkok, supporting a high‑performing team advising on complex local and cross‑border dispute matters. This is an excellent opportunity for a capable and detail‑driven paralegal to work closely with leading disputes lawyers in a collaborative and international environment.

Based in our Bangkok office, you will provide essential paralegal support across a broad range of dispute resolution matters, including litigation, arbitration and regulatory investigations. You will work closely with partners, associates and other legal professionals, contributing to the efficient and high‑quality delivery of client work.

In this role, you will be responsible for a wide range of paralegal and administrative support activities, which may include:

  • Assisting with the preparation, review and management of legal documents, pleadings, submissions and correspondence.
  • Conducting legal and factual research including litigation research and the preparation of related reports and summarising findings for the legal team.
  • Managing matter files, document databases and electronic discovery platforms.
  • Coordinating filing corporate and company-related documentation with relevant authorities, including company incorporation, corporate registrations, amendments to corporate records, and other statutory filings.
  • Coordinating the filing of court documents with the relevant courts and other relevant government authorities, and managing deadlines and procedural requirements.
  • Liaising with courts, external counsel, clients and other stakeholders as required, including coordination and communication with other relevant government authorities.
  • Supporting hearing and trial preparation, including bundles and chronologies.
  • Assisting with general practice management and knowledge support tasks.

To be successful in this role, you will ideally have:

  • Previous experience as a paralegal or legal assistant, preferably within a disputes, litigation or arbitration practice
  • Strong organisational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Confidence working with legal documents and document management systems
  • A proactive, flexible and team‑oriented approach
  • Proficiency in English; Thai language capability will be highly regarded
